1. "Art of Banners" Banners are ideal identifiers for place, time and belonging. Fern will gently guide the group/individual through the process of banner making; drawing from the Tuthill and union banners of the late 19th century. The group/individual will design, develop and produce a banner based on traditional banner making.

2. "Art of Democracy" designed to encourage and engage creative ways of looking and participating in democracy. Are you an individual or a group that has something to say?

Explore the legacy the suffragists and suffragettes in Australia, America and England have left. You will discover how to design, develop and produce a campaign based on their ephemera. For example some of the material they produced were fans, books, cards, posters, banners, and art works. Your campaign will be unique, memorable and creative it can be large or small, personal or public ideal for groups and collaborative projects.
